I tried playing iTunes in the background, and it's definitely NOT a problem
with sound hardware gone to sleep.

I guess this is a known problem with both NSImage & NSSound, being that they
are slow/unresponsive. Learning Cocoa with Objective C had a method for
preloading images because NSImage is slow. I tried to do a similar thing
with NSSound, but it also didn't work.

I searched through the CocoaDev archive, I'm surprised that nobody has
brought this up before. Certainly there's got to be a way around this aside
from playing a silent sound?

On 1/21/04 1:44 AM, "m" <email@hidden> wrote:

> On Jan 20, 2004, at 5:48 PM, Mike Brinkman wrote:
>
>> I wrote a simple Tic Tac Toe game in Cocoa, and it works pretty well
>> for the
>> most part. The only real problem I'm encountering is that the first
>> time I
>> play a sound, there is a brief delay.
>
> Betcha what's going on here is that the sound hardware has gone to
> sleep and takes a moment to turn on. See if it doesn't happen if you
> have iTunes playing something when your app makes sound.
>
> A workaround I have used is to have a silent sound that I start playing
> a moment before I'm likely to need a sound. You could also just
> periodically play the sound to keep the sound hardware awake.
>
> A less quick and dirty solution would be to programatically disable the
> powering down of the sound system by the power manager. Have a gander
> at the docs.
